Please join us for a presentation from the Economist Intelligence Unit on The Global Economy: Populism, Protectionism and Potential. Global Chief Economist Simon Baptist will discuss emerging economic opportunities, challenges, and risks. Baptist will also address:

  • Which economies are the ones to watch and the implications for global supply chains.
  • What does Xi Jinping's declared 'new era' for China mean in practice?
  • Will tensions on the Korean peninsula reach boiling point?
  • Is a global trade war looming?
